jackic

Quote from: Jean-Marie on 19:52, 29 April 25Yes, I can do that for version 2. In the meantime, if you can poke your memory, try :
POKE &DE5D,9
POKE &DE5E,&20


Thanks, just in case this can be of help to someone, you can achieve this on original hardware extracting "turrican.scr" and changing the offset 12A0 from "02 04" to "09 20", I did this by basically by brute forcing, couldn't have done it without the pokes.

Quote from: OneVision on Yesterday at 10:24I'm rather a member of the team : Button 1 fire, Button 2 jump.
And by the way, how would the game be playable on the GX with only 2 buttons ? I guess it's not, and only playable on a PLUS.
Well, you can use both buttons for attack and "special attack" and jump pushing up or, alternatively, map button 2 for jumps and the up direction for "special attack". but then you will not be able to do the spin attack, achieved by crouching+"special attack".
